Amplifying Your Voice: SSFPA Representation

In the dynamic landscape of food processing and agriculture, having a say in the decisions that affect your business is critical. The Small Scale Food Processors Association is your advocate, ensuring that the unique perspectives and needs of small and medium processors and growers are not just heard, but acted upon. Our active participation in key boards and committees across the country amplifies our members’ voices, shaping policies and practices that foster a more supportive environment for your business. Explore some of these committees below.

Targeted Advocacy: We represent you at crucial tables where decisions are made, ensuring the interests of small and medium businesses are a priority.

Influencing Policy: Our involvement in national and regional committees means we directly influence policies and regulations affecting the food processing industry, from safety standards to economic support.

Strategic Connections: Through our representation, we build strategic relationships with government bodies and industry leaders, opening doors for our members to opportunities and collaborations.

Your Needs, Our Mission: Whether it’s advocating for more accessible funding, influencing food safety regulations, or supporting the development of food hubs, our representation is guided by your needs and challenges.
